Is Pizza Safe to Consume at 12 Weeks of Pregnancy?
Yes, you can eat pizza during pregnancy at 12 weeks still but the toppings should be either fresh vegetables or cooked products and the cheese should be pasteurized. It is better to have a gynecologist or a nutritionist recommend a healthy diet plan during pregnancy.

Asked for Female | 26
What does a faint pink line on a home pregnancy test followed by disappearance mean?
Since most home pregnancy tests turn a faint pink color, even if it is just a slight tint, this implies a positive result, even if it is weak. However, the vanishing of the line within a couple of minutes can be a sign of a chemical pregnancy which indicates that an egg that was fertilized doesn’t develop properly. One should be keen on consulting a gynecologist or an obstetrician to have confirmation of the pregnancy.
